正n邊型: n%2==0 n*(n-1)*(n-2)*(n-3)/24-tmp*(tmp-1)/2+1 (tmp=n/2) n%2!=0 n*(n-1)*(n-2)*(n-3)/24 非正n邊型 n*(n-1)*(n*n-5*n+6)/24 ...
題目描述:對於一個 n 個頂點的凸多邊形,它的任何三條對角線都不會交於一點。請求出圖形中對角線交點的個數。 由於剛開始學java,故用java寫一下。 這個問題其實可以轉換為排列問題,每兩條不相交的對角線必有一個交點,並且對應四個頂點,所以轉化為了求C N, 的問題。也就是n n n n 。為了避免連乘數字太大,可以變換成n n n n 。這樣能成功的原因是n和n 里面一定有一個 的倍數,同理n, ...
2020-10-23 17:30 0 912 推薦指數:
正n邊型: n%2==0 n*(n-1)*(n-2)*(n-3)/24-tmp*(tmp-1)/2+1 (tmp=n/2) n%2!=0 n*(n-1)*(n-2)*(n-3)/24 非正n邊型 n*(n-1)*(n*n-5*n+6)/24 ...
矩陣中的對角線 行列式: 行列式等於三角矩陣的主對角線上元素的乘積 特征值 與 矩陣的跡: 特征值 的和 等於 矩陣的跡 矩陣的跡:矩陣對角線元素之和 三角矩陣主對角線的元素是它的特征值 ...
題目:給定一個含有 M x N 個元素的矩陣(M 行,N 列),請以對角線遍歷的順序返回這個矩陣中的所有元素,對角線遍歷如下圖所示。 說明: 思路:觀察規律,主要思考這個矩陣是怎么遍歷的,遍歷方向如何,研究可得,遍歷方向由元素所在行列和決定,為偶數向上,奇數向下。 所以,即先創建空列表 ...
某個同學的題目,寫了一下。 題目大概是這樣的: 編寫函數,求出二維數組主對角線、次對角線以及周邊元素之和。 要求:二維數組的行數、列數、數組元素在main函數中由鍵盤輸入。 #include <stdio.h> int main() { int row ...
求一個3 X 3的整形矩陣對角線元素之和 【答案解析】 矩陣:即二維數組,矩陣行和列相等的二維數組稱為方陣。 1 2 3 4 5 6 7 8 9 左上角到右下角對角線上數字:行下標和列下標相等 右上角到左下角對角線上數字:列下標減1 行下標加一 通過兩個循環來取到對角線上的元素 ...
方法1 方法2 sum1=a[0][0]+a[1][1]+a[2][2];sum2=a[0][2]+a[1][1]+a[2][0]; ...
#include <stdio.h>int main(){ int a[3][3],sum,i,j; printf("please input array:\n"); for(i=0;i<3;i++) for(j=0;j<3;j++ ...